Georgia - Re-Export of Screwdrivers

Since 2014, Georgia Re-Export of Screwdrivers rose 37.9% year on year. At $3,622.35 in 2019, the country was number 15 among other countries in Re-Export of Screwdrivers. Georgia is overtaken by Togo, which was ranked number 14 at $4,142.99 and is followed by Namibia with $2,325.08. United States ranked the highest with $7,231,349 in 2019, that is an increase of 11.8% versus 2018. United Arab Emirates, Canada and Bahrain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Uganda witnessed the best average annual growth at +223.5% per year, while Antigua and Barbuda recorded the worst performance at -68.1% per year.
